    Taoism is mainly divided into five factions.

    They are the Righteous One, the Whole True Dao, the True Dao Sect, the Taiyi Sect, and the Pure Enlightenment Path.

    Taoism is a traditional religion that originated in China and was formed in the Eastern Han Dynasty. It is the product of the synthesis of ancient immortal thoughts, Taoist doctrines, ghost and god sacrifices, and witchcraft such as divination, talismans, and forbidden spells.

    The distribution of Taoism is generally believed to have begun in the Song and Yuan dynasties. There are 5 major schools that are more influential in the history of Taoism:

    Zhengyi: There are Lingbao factions, Zhengyi factions, and Jingming factions below.

    Quanzhen Dao: There are also southern sects and northern sects. There are also many tribes, such as the Longmen faction, the Yuxian faction, the Nanwu faction, the Suishan faction, the Yuanshan faction, the Huashan faction, the Qingjing faction, etc.

    True Dao Sect: Founded during the Jin Dynasty, it gradually declined after the Yuan Dynasty.

    Taiyi: Founded during the Jin Dynasty, it gradually declined after the end of the Yuan Dynasty.

    Jingming Dao: Founded in the Southern Song Dynasty, it declined after the Ming Dynasty.

    After the Ming Dynasty, Taoism was divided into two major sects, Zhengyi and Quanzhendao, and all other sects were grouped under these two sects. At present, the Baiyun Temple in Beijing has the "General Book of Zhuzhen Sects", which lists a total of 86 Taoist sects, but in fact there are only 80.

    Zhengyi: Zhengyi is the five buckets of rice road in the late Eastern Han Dynasty, which was later renamed Tianshi Dao, Zhengyi. Its Taoist priests can practice at home, do not abstain from meat, and can marry and have children. Its Taoist temple is generally called the "Temple of Descendants".

    Quanzhen Dao: Quanzhen Dao flourished in the Jin and Yuan dynasties and was the largest and most important of the Song and Yuan New Taoist sects. Representative Wang Chongyang, Qiu Chuji. The Quanzhen Tao emphasizes pure cultivation, and its Taoist priests must be monks and vegetarians. Its Taoist temple is generally known as the "Ten Directions Jungle".

    There are many sects within Taoism, and their names vary depending on the distribution of the sect. According to the theory, there are five categories: the Jishan School, the Classic School, the Fulu School, the Danding School (Jindan School), and the Zhan Yan School. According to the region, there are Longmen faction, Laoshan faction, Suishan faction, Yushan faction, Huashan faction, Yuanshan faction, old Huashan faction, Heshan faction, Huoshan faction, Wudang faction and so on.

    According to the people, there are the Shaoyang faction (Wang Xuanfu), the Zhengyang faction (Zhong Lihan), the Chunyang faction (Lu Dongbin), the Haichan faction (Liu Cao), the Sanfeng faction (Zhang Sanfeng), the Sazu faction (Sa Shoujian), the Ziyang faction (Zhang Boduan), the Wuliu faction (Wu Chongxu, Liu Huayang), the Chongyang faction (Wang Zhongfu), the Yin Xi faction (Guan Yin), the Jinshan faction (Sun Xuanqing), and the Yanzu faction (Yan Xiyan). According to the Daomen, there are mixed yuan faction (Taishang Laojun), Nanwu faction (Tan Churui), Qingjing faction (Sun Buer), Jinhui faction (Qi Benshou), Zhengyi faction (Zhang Xujing), Qingwei faction (Ma Danyang), Tianxian faction (Lu Chunyang), Xuanwu faction (Zhenwu Emperor), Jingming faction (Xu Jingyang), Yunyang faction (Zhang Guolao), void faction (Li Tiegui), Yunhe faction (He Xiangu), Jindan faction (Cao Guoshu), jade line faction (Qiaoyang Zhenren), Lingbao faction (Zhou Zu), Taiyi faction (Xiao Baozhen), Quanzhen faction (Wang Chongyang), Zhengyi Sect (Zhang Zongyan), Vacuum Sect (Guzu), Tieguan Sect (Zhou Zu), Rixin Sect, Natural Sect (Zhang Sanfeng), Congenital Sect, Guanghui Sect, etc. In history, there are also Zhengyi Sect (Zhang Daoling), Southern Sect (Lu Chunyang), Northern Sect (Wang Chongyang), Zhen Dazong (Zhang Qingzhi), Taiyi Sect (Huangdong Yi), the division of the five major sects and the division of the four major sects of Tianshi Dao, Quanzhen Dao, Lingbao Dao, and Qingwei Dao.

Nowadays, many sects are in decline, and the famous sects that still exist include the Quanzhen Sect in the north, the Zhengyi Sect in the south, the Maoshan Sect, the Laoshan Sect, the Wudang Sect, the Lushan Sect, and the folk Taoist sects in Hong Kong and Taiwan.
